Calcium plays a crucial role in maintaining optimal health within the human body, serving as an essential mineral that contributes to various physiological functions. Calcium blood tests are conducted to assess the adequacy of calcium levels circulating in the bloodstream, providing valuable insights into the individual’s overall health. Deviations from the normal range of calcium in the blood, either in excess or deficiency, can serve as important indicators of underlying medical conditions. Elevated or reduced levels may suggest potential issues with bone health, kidney function, hormone regulation, or other systemic disorders. Monitoring and interpreting calcium blood levels are integral components of comprehensive healthcare, enabling timely identification and management of potential health concerns.
